To mask out the values of secure request parameters, specify the parameter. If the dependency is not found you can specify your own repository using the repository argument. Pdf plugin allows your grails application to generate pdfs and send them to the browser by converting existing pages in your application to pdf on the fly. Refer to the section on url mapping in the grails user guide which details grails url mappings configured spring beans. When a job completes it returns its status plus a variety of other parameters to the given url. This can be very helpful when integrating with sharepoint or other web portals. I am calling a jsp program passing some parameters and in the url i am seeing those parameters. The plugins configuration values all start with grails. Gradle will then download all needed dependencies including grails and. What grails developers can learn from the githubrails mass assignment vulnerability.
If you look at the url displayed for your question it does not use an id, it uses a. This is a problem in general for security since any url rules for edit, delete, save, etc. Without this plugin, if you have a custom validation that you want to perform on a domain object, you have to use a generic validator constraint and define it inline. They increase encapsulation by hiding the inner class from other classes, which do not need to know about it. Hide menu, header, etc from webplayer by adding the options parameter to the webplayer url, you can hide the header, toolbar, export visualization, about, etc. There may be situation where the data in body for the request is need to be read. With this authentication in place, users are prompted with the standard browser login dialog instead of being redirected to a login page. Hide selected tab retrieving parameters passed in a url from a 3rd party website in separate iframe and filtering report re. Before installing grails you will need as a minimum a java development kit jdk installed version 1.
Thoughts what grails developers can learn from the. Url access parameter reference sql server reporting. Groovy servers pages or gsp for short is grails view technology. The processurl is a background process that has no interaction with your front end view, runs in the background. If you look at the project structure, youll see that it doesnt look much like a standard grails. I want customize url like this mailboxmessagedetailsinbox. Grails description grails, or groovyon grails, is a web framework inspired as many others by the wellknown rubyonrails framework. This grails plugin allows you to create custom domain constraints for validating domain objects. This will create a grails core directory in your current working directory containing all the project source files. This capability makes referencing documents and folders into a custom application simple and consistent even when the source code in ibm content.
Hide parameters url jquery and grails stack overflow. How to hide the parameters in the url jsp forum at. How to hide the url parameters using get and post methods when using url api to execute a report in microstrategy web 9. If formtrue, there must be enough data within the remaining attributes to resolve to a url if sent to the createlink grails. Redirects the current action to another action, optionally passing parameters andor errors. To mask out the values of secure request parameters, specify the parameter names in the grails. Java servlet hidden field example examples java code geeks. There should also be an update attribute set if there is data passed back from the asynchronous call to the forms url. If you look at the url displayed for your question it does not use an id, it uses a named page. Web app, step by step grails edition object computing, inc. Although grails provides the same capability through the request object, it goes a bit further by providing a mutable map of request parameters called params. If formtrue, there must be enough data within the remaining attributes to resolve to a url if sent to the createlink grails method. This framework is built with strong adherence to the mvc design paradigm.
Hi, hiding them in the address bar is not possible. Grails jenjir plugin interacts with jenkins, trigger buildsview historical build logs via grails app using builder with live output returned via websockets. The wsprocessurl is a url which wsprocessname is the. For example, you can customize the rendering of a report on a native mode report server or in a sharepoint library. It also copies a properties file called perties to the i18n directory of your application overwriting any file of the same name. In this guide you are going to create a grails app which consumes a third party rest api. Ibm content navigator desktops, features, folders, and documents can be remotely invoked by using a url based mechanism to send the users browser to a specified url with information about the unique identifier of the item in the repository.
Home grails tutorial on how to create grails seo friendly url. You can use the following parameters as part of a url to configure the look and feel of your sql server 2016 reporting services or later ssrs reports. Grails has some built in common public maven repositories that will be used to resolve the dependency. Take a look at the rendering plugin for similar functionality. Variables can also be used to dynamically construct the controller and action name. The first time the wrapper is executed it will download and configure a grails installation. Create link to groovydocjavadoc output at the given url. The next step is to get a grails installation from the source. The reason for this suggestion is because i dont think url params and request body should both be put into the same object i.
In this guide you are going to create your first grails application. How to hide url parameters in grails stack overflow. Creating your first grails application grails guides. Urlmappingsholder instance that stores all of the url mappings urlmappingstargetsource a spring hotswappabletargetsource used in autoreloading. Url access of the report server in sql server reporting services ssrs enables you to send commands to a report server through a url request. Once youve generated the scaffold views, you can customize the forms and tables using the taglib provided by the plugin see the fields plugin docs for details. You can download the source code for groovy and take a look at the. In particular, it makes a strict separation between controller components, written in the underlying groovy language and view components, written in html and gsp groovy server pages, a. Refer to the section on url mapping in the grails user guide which details grails url mappings.
The underlying system uses the xhtmlrenderer component from to do the rendering. Compilestatic class restbuilder main api entry to the synchronous version of the rest lowlevel client api. This is a grails plugin that integrates a custom url shortener inside your grails application. Is there a javascript i can use to hide the url parameters in the address bar.
How to pass an or condition in the url of a report. By including the command object in the parameter list of. In this tutorial, we will show you how to handle the hidden field in an html. It is the sort of thing that is used in phishing attacks. This is done by posting to the index action but with a special parameter that indicates which action to invoke. Like any environmentspecific configuration parameters, you wrap them in an environments block. The grails scaffolding templates make use of the the fields plugin. Just put one taglib call in your layout and your static javascript files can make use of grails urlmappings example usage jquery.
Githubs security was breached due to a vulnerability in rails. Hide parameters url jquery and grails ask question asked 2 years. Technically, you could hardcode the url into the mailto. Hi this is a sample url mailboxmessagedetailsinbox79 as you can see there is and id parameter after last slash 79. The individual tokens in the url would again be mapped into the params object with values available for year, month, day, id and so on. You could do a serverside forward instead of a redirect. If you missed one, the url will still be generated but with all the params at the end of the url following the. Subscribe to our newsletter and download the java servlet ultimate guide.
Please suggest me ideas to hide parameters in the url or any secured way of coding. Grails has a convenient feature where it supports multiple submit actions per form via the tag. When grails logs a stacktrace, the log message may include the names and values of all of the request parameters for the current request. A grails plugin to provide clientside reverse url mappings outside of gsp files. It is designed to be familiar for users of technologies such as asp and jsp, but to be far more flexible and intuitive. Url mappings may now include a plugin attribute to indicate that the. If i change the parameter value at url address and refresh the page, it pulls back the information of the newly enter parameter. Grails params missing values with put and patch after add. Now users of the web application can see and change the request parameter values from the address bar and they see the rec. This might require additional code in source pages, but should not require logic changes in the target. Urlmappingsholder instance that stores all of the url mappings. After installation, the setting table in your database should have a unique index on the code column, but since hibernate may or may not create this index, you are advised to check it exists otherwise. Consume and test a thirdparty rest api grails guides. Grails also suffers from the same vulnerability, but there are ways to protect your app.
861 344 339 1087 1443 683 909 1421 209 421 915 1572 782 1064 1317 688 1316 445 249 1572 444 1385 1374 800 630 549 1170 1340 1272 1338 1622 3 1022 43 155 1033 1010 1479 927 892 960